Questions to Ask Potential Rental Companies
Prior to partnering with a property management firm, it is wise to inquire about their procedures and services. Here are a few questions to consider:
- What is your approach to tenant screening and background verifications?
- Can you explain your fee structure along with any potential hidden fees?
- What processes are in place for handling maintenance issues and ensuring a quick response?
- Could you supply references from current or previous property owners or tenants?
These questions help ensure that you grasp what read this you’re getting and that the company’s practices align with your needs. It’s always best to choose a company that is clear about all details.
